Evosales Purchase
Before purchasing anything, I read up on it, plan out how stuff will work out and listen to what people say. Before purchasing my motorcycle, I contacted evosales and got a quick reply from Maya. We talked for a week about things on the motorcycle. She was very helpful and guided me through the process.
On Sunday, Aug 1st, I purchased a dual sport motorcycle from evosales for $1199. On Tuesday, Aug 3rd, The bike shipped and I reccieved an email with a tracking number and all the info. On Friday, Aug 6th, I got a call from Inter-Coastal shipping and we set up a date for monday. The truck showed up at 11:00 monday, Aug 9th and the bike was the only thing in the truck. The truck had no liftgate, but me and the driver and my bro and sis were able to get it into the shop with no problems. The box was in great shape, so I signed and let the driver go on his way. I opened it to find a bike in great shape with few scratches. The only problem was it came with no instructions or mirrors. I emailed Maya and she told me to contact Moises and I did and he sent me an email with a like to an assembley guide and he said the mirrors would be out that day. My bike did not want to start, and there were some connectors that were not plugged in so I hooked them up and my kill switch and starter started working, but still no ignition. I looked in the bottom of the insturment cluster and there were 2 wires touching, I bent them back and wala, she cranked. Overall I give evosales an A+ because they gave me great service and still have after the sale so to anyone intrested in evo, I say go with it! Mike |
